Today, on June 17, Russia attacked the Poltava district in the Poltava region, Ukraine, hitting civilian infrastructure, damaging several high-rise buildings. A fire broke out over an area of approximately 100 square meters, power lines have been damaged.

According to preliminary data, at least 12 people got injured.
